usb usb6: Requested nonsensical USBDEVFS_URB_SHORT_NOT_OK. ================================================================== BUG: KCSAN: data-race in data_alloc / prb_reserve write to 0xffffffff8686b930 of 8 bytes by task 29269 on cpu 1: data_alloc+0x280/0x2e0 kernel/printk/printk_ringbuffer.c:1102 prb_reserve+0x807/0xaf0 kernel/printk/printk_ringbuffer.c:1685 vprintk_store+0x56d/0x860 kernel/printk/printk.c:2299 vprintk_emit+0x10d/0x580 kernel/printk/printk.c:2399 vprintk_default+0x26/0x30 kernel/printk/printk.c:2438 vprintk+0x1d/0x30 kernel/printk/printk_safe.c:82 _printk+0x79/0xa0 kernel/printk/printk.c:2448 vlan_vid0_add net/8021q/vlan.c:368 [inline] vlan_device_event+0x10b6/0x11b0 net/8021q/vlan.c:411 notifier_call_chain kernel/notifier.c:85 [inline] raw_notifier_call_chain+0x6f/0x1b0 kernel/notifier.c:453 call_netdevice_notifiers_info+0xae/0x100 net/core/dev.c:2229 call_netdevice_notifiers_extack net/core/dev.c:2267 [inline] call_netdevice_notifiers net/core/dev.c:2281 [inline] __dev_notify_flags+0xff/0x1a0 net/core/dev.c:-1 rtnl_configure_link net/core/rtnetlink.c:3599 [inline] rtnl_newlink_create+0x3f7/0x620 net/core/rtnetlink.c:3843 __rtnl_newlink net/core/rtnetlink.c:3950 [inline] rtnl_newlink+0xf29/0x12d0 net/core/rtnetlink.c:4065 rtnetlink_rcv_msg+0x5fe/0x6d0 net/core/rtnetlink.c:6951 netlink_rcv_skb+0x123/0x220 net/netlink/af_netlink.c:2552 rtnetlink_rcv+0x1c/0x30 net/core/rtnetlink.c:6978 netlink_unicast_kernel net/netlink/af_netlink.c:1320 [inline] netlink_unicast+0x5c0/0x690 net/netlink/af_netlink.c:1346 netlink_sendmsg+0x58b/0x6b0 net/netlink/af_netlink.c:1896 sock_sendmsg_nosec net/socket.c:727 [inline] __sock_sendmsg+0x145/0x180 net/socket.c:742 ____sys_sendmsg+0x31e/0x4e0 net/socket.c:2630 ___sys_sendmsg+0x17b/0x1d0 net/socket.c:2684 __sys_sendmsg net/socket.c:2716 [inline] __do_sys_sendmsg net/socket.c:2721 [inline] __se_sys_sendmsg net/socket.c:2719 [inline] __x64_sys_sendmsg+0xd4/0x160 net/socket.c:2719 x64_sys_call+0x191e/0x3000 arch/x86/include/generated/asm/syscalls_64.h:47 do_syscall_x64 arch/x86/entry/syscall_64.c:63 [inline] do_syscall_64+0xd2/0x200 arch/x86/entry/syscall_64.c:94 entry_SYSCALL_64_after_hwframe+0x77/0x7f read to 0xffffffff8686b930 of 8 bytes by task 29273 on cpu 0: desc_read kernel/printk/printk_ringbuffer.c:479 [inline] desc_push_tail kernel/printk/printk_ringbuffer.c:775 [inline] desc_reserve kernel/printk/printk_ringbuffer.c:921 [inline] prb_reserve+0x220/0xaf0 kernel/printk/printk_ringbuffer.c:1635 vprintk_store+0x56d/0x860 kernel/printk/printk.c:2299 vprintk_emit+0x10d/0x580 kernel/printk/printk.c:2399 vprintk_default+0x26/0x30 kernel/printk/printk.c:2438 vprintk+0x1d/0x30 kernel/printk/printk_safe.c:82 _printk+0x79/0xa0 kernel/printk/printk.c:2448 vhci_hub_control+0x64b/0xe80 drivers/usb/usbip/vhci_hcd.c:349 rh_call_control drivers/usb/core/hcd.c:656 [inline] rh_urb_enqueue drivers/usb/core/hcd.c:821 [inline] usb_hcd_submit_urb+0xc0f/0x1200 drivers/usb/core/hcd.c:1542 usb_submit_urb+0xace/0xc20 drivers/usb/core/urb.c:587 proc_do_submiturb+0x19c7/0x1d20 drivers/usb/core/devio.c:1971 proc_submiturb+0x7b/0xa0 drivers/usb/core/devio.c:2003 usbdev_do_ioctl drivers/usb/core/devio.c:2703 [inline] usbdev_ioctl+0xcb6/0x1700 drivers/usb/core/devio.c:2827 vfs_ioctl fs/ioctl.c:51 [inline] __do_sys_ioctl fs/ioctl.c:597 [inline] __se_sys_ioctl+0xce/0x140 fs/ioctl.c:583 __x64_sys_ioctl+0x43/0x50 fs/ioctl.c:583 x64_sys_call+0x1816/0x3000 arch/x86/include/generated/asm/syscalls_64.h:17 do_syscall_x64 arch/x86/entry/syscall_64.c:63 [inline] do_syscall_64+0xd2/0x200 arch/x86/entry/syscall_64.c:94 entry_SYSCALL_64_after_hwframe+0x77/0x7f value changed: 0x0000000000123be8 -> 0x00000000001e3160 Reported by Kernel Concurrency Sanitizer on: CPU: 0 UID: 0 PID: 29273 Comm: syz.7.12983 Not tainted syzkaller #0 PREEMPT(voluntary) Hardware name: Google Google Compute Engine/Google Compute Engine, BIOS Google 10/02/2025 ================================================================== vhci_hcd: invalid port number 96 vhci_hcd: default hub control req: 0311 v0005 i0060 l7